If Auto is in demand, then should be more expensive. But the latest pricing is MT more expensive by $3k. :s22:

Economies of scale. And production cost for automatic gearbox is getting lower when compared to the 80s and 90s. Even in Europe where manuals are preferred, the price gap between manual and auto is not huge when you compare the same spec model.
